Beer Cheese Fondue

A classic beer cheese fondue recipe that takes less than 30 minutes to make. Beer and cheese are a match made in heaven.

Ingredients
½
lb
sharp cheddar cheese
½
lb
gruyère cheese
1
tbsp
cornstarch
1
clove garlic
more if desired
1
cup
beer
used Yuengling
fresh cracked pepper
to taste
brown mustard
to taste, if desired
milk
if needed to thin it out
Instructions
In a small bowl, grate cheese and add tbsp cornstarch. Set aside.
In a pot, add the crushed garlic and brown over medium/low heat.
Once it is browned and aromatic add the beer. Heat to a simmer.
Slowly add cheese until it melts, stirring constantly.
Once ingredients are fully combined then pour into the already heated fondue pot.
Notes
Leftovers can we reheated in fondue pot or in the microwave.
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
